Fitted electrodes
2 measuring electrodes for signal detection
1 empty pipe detection electrode for empty pipe detection/temperature measurement (only DN 15
to 150 (½ to 6"))
Process connections
With O-ring seal
Welding nipple (DIN EN ISO 1127, ODT/SMS, ISO 2037)
Flange (EN (DIN), ASME, JIS)
Flange from PVDF (EN (DIN), ASME, JIS)
External thread
Internal thread
Hose connection
PVC adhesive sleeve
With aseptic molded seal:
Coupling (DIN 11851, DIN 11864-1, ISO 2853, SMS 1145)
Flange DIN 11864-2
For information on the different materials used in the process connections →  79
Surface roughness
Stainless steel electrodes, 1.4435 (316L); Alloy C22, 2.4602 (UNS N06022); platinum; tantalum:
≤ 0.3 to 0.5 µm (11.8 to 19.7 µin)
(All data relate to parts in contact with fluid)
Liner with PFA:
≤ 0.4 µm (15.7 µin)
(All data relate to parts in contact with fluid)
Stainless steel process connections:
With O-ring seal: ≤ 1.6 µm (63 µin)
With aseptic seal: ≤ 0.8 µm (31.5 µin)
Optional: ≤ 0.38 µm (15 µin)
(All data relate to parts in contact with fluid)
Operability
Operating concept
Operator-oriented menu structure for user-specific tasks
Commissioning
Operation
Diagnostics
Expert level
Fast and safe commissioning
Guided menus ("Make-it-run" wizards) for applications
Menu guidance with brief explanations of the individual parameter functions
Device access via Web server
Optional: WLAN access to device via mobile handheld terminal
Reliable operation
Operation in local language →  81
Uniform operating philosophy applied to device and operating tools
If replacing electronic modules, transfer the device configuration via the integrated memory
(integrated HistoROM) which contains the process and measuring device data and the event
logbook. No need to reconfigure.
Efficient diagnostics increase measurement availability
Troubleshooting measures can be called up via the device and in the operating tools
Diverse simulation options, logbook for events that occur and optional line recorder functions
